To provide an infrared sensor capable of improving sensitivity without changing a view angle, a number of detection areas, or size.
An infrared sensor comprises: a multi-split lens 1 having a plurality of lenses 10 combined on one curved surface, and in which a focal position is the same for all the lenses; and an infrared detection element 2 disposed at a position nearer to the multi-split lens 1 than the focal position. Further, the infrared sensor includes an optical element 3 disposed between the multi-split lens 1 and the infrared detection element 2. The optical element 3 is designed to have capability for refracting infrared rays which are inclining towards a normal line at the center of a surface on a multi-split lens 1 side of the infrared detection element 2, out of infrared rays incoming from the respective lenses 10, so that an angle formed against the normal line is decreased to make the infrared rays incident on the infrared detection element 2.
